On 02/29/2012 04:09 AM, Andre Robatino wrote:
> When yum distro-sync updates some packages and downgrades others, during the
> transaction it says "Updating  :" for the updated packages, but "Installing  :"
> for the downgraded ones. Is there a reason for that? I would only expect to see
> "Installing  :" for a newly installed package.
> 
> (I considered posting this on the test list, since distro-sync is more commonly
> used there, but it's not exclusive to test releases.)

Probably just a cosmetic thing because technically a downgrade is just
removal and installation of the older version as a new package.  File a
bug report.
